READ ME FIRST!
The EMCEE MBSR100MW is a professional solid state low-power MBS Band
retransmission repeater (amplifier) system, and is formed from a combination of
a pre-selected frequency input pre-amplifier module (P/N 701007) and an AGC
controlled 100mW post amplifier module (P/N 50800002A), each of which is in a
separate chassis/housing and connected via an interconnecting coaxial cable
with Type ‘N’ connectors. The system is capable of retransmitting from one to
seven MBS channels with either analog NTSC or digital modulation. The system
provides an end-to-end electrical gain typically 70dB. The system has no
frequency generating circuits, and as such, the output carrier frequencies and
modulations are dependent on the inputs. The pre-amplifier contains a dual
section inter-digital filter system which provides high Q MBS pass-band circuitry
at the input stage. This is to prevent pre-amplifier input overloads due to out of
band interference from close stations utilizing the LBS and UBS bands. The input
pre-selection also prevents the retransmission of out of band signals. The output
(post) amplifier has an output AGC range of 20dB, with a 20dBm average power
output power threshold. The AGC circuitry is designed to provide a constant low
distortion output with varying input signal power levels due to fades and other
signal anomalies.
The system has the following average output power capability:
1 Channel @ 20dBm/Channel ±1dB (20dBm Composite Power)
2 Channels @ 17dBm/Channel ±1dB (20dBm Composite Power)
4 Channels @ 14dBm/Channel ±1dB (20dBm Composite Power)
7 Channels @ 11dBm/Channel ±1dB (20dBm Composite Power)
Warning: DO NOT EXCEED 20dBm Composite Power Output!
